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$155.76 | 3.724% | $161.5605 | $161.56 | $161.55 | $161.60 |
Purchase #2 | $51.82 | 11.189% | $57.6181 | $57.62 | $57.60 | $57.60 |
Purchase #3 | $248.66 | 6.268% | $264.246 | $264.25 | $264.25 | $264.20 |
Purchase #4 | $190.90 | 8.138% | $206.4354 | $206.44 | $206.45 | $206.40 |
Purchase #5 | $41.37 | 13.670% | $47.0253 | $47.03 | $47.05 | $47.00 |
Purchase #6 | $240.52 | 10.745% | $266.3639 | $266.36 | $266.35 | $266.40 |
Purchase #7 | $193.66 | 7.809% | $208.7829 | $208.78 | $208.80 | $208.80 |
7 purchase totals = | $1,122.69 | $1,212.0321 | $1,212.04 | $1,212.05 | $1,212.00 |
